Can I get a different Social Security number?
The Social Security Administration does allow you to change your number, but only under limited circumstances, such as identity theft or if your safety is in danger. You will also need to supply appropriate documentation to support your application for a new number. Social Security Administration. -
Is it possible to get a new Social Security number?
You can change your Social Security number, but you must have a valid reason and proper documentation for proof. Qualifying reasons for a new SSN include repeated identity theft attempts or harassment and abuse. -
How do I recover from SSN theft?
Then visit IdentityTheft.gov or call 1-877-438-4338. Answer questions about what happened to you. Get a recovery plan that's just for you. You can create an account on the website. The account helps you with recovery steps. The account also helps you track your progress. -
Can you have 2 Social Security numbers?
Most persons have only one SSN. In certain limited situations, SSA can assign you a new number. If you receive a new SSN, you should use the new number. However, your old and new number will remain linked in our records to ensure that your earnings are credited properly. -
Can you change your SSN if it gets stolen?
You can't get a new Social Security number: If your Social Security card is lost or stolen, but there's no evidence that someone is using your number. -

What happens if my SSN gets stolen?
A dishonest person who has your Social Security number can use it to get other personal information about you. Identity thieves can use your number and your good credit to apply for more credit in your name. Then, when they use the credit cards and don't pay the bills, it damages your credit. -
Can you change your Social Security number if someone has it?
If someone is using your SSN to track where you work and live and wants to do you harm, you can change it. Again, you'll need to show proof of your situation like police reports.
